2.

The Titanic's maiden voyage was from Southampton to New York City.

Click to reveal answer ›

Easy
✓ TRUE

She departed Southampton, England, on April 10, 1912, with planned stops at Cherbourg and Queenstown before heading to New York.

3.

The Titanic's orchestra played music as the ship sank, and all band members died.

Click to reveal answer ›

Medium
✓ TRUE

The eight-member band, led by Wallace Hartley, played to calm passengers and went down with the ship. All perished; their heroism is widely recognized.

6.

Only two dogs survived the Titanic sinking, both small breeds.

Click to reveal answer ›

Hard
✗ FALSE

Three dogs survived: two Pomeranians and a Pekingese. They were small enough to be carried onto lifeboats by their owners.

7.

The Titanic was originally designed to carry 64 lifeboats, but only 20 were installed.

Click to reveal answer ›

Hard
✓ TRUE

Designer Alexander Carlisle proposed 64 boats, but White Star Line reduced it to 20 to avoid deck clutter, deeming them unnecessary.

8.

A coal fire burned in one of the Titanic's bunkers before the Titanic even left port.

Click to reveal answer ›

Hard
✓ TRUE

A fire smoldered in coal bunker number 10 for days before departure, as noted in official inquiries and crew testimonies.
